    Re: miele W562 stops excess detergent light flashig

    High level 140mm still detected, likely the pressure vessel is clogged or appliance is not getting rid of water in time, if for instance appliance went to spin before all water was out this would pressurise pressure vessel & pressure switch & F5 excess detergent fault code would be generated.
    Take a look at the drainage manifold (running up inside at back) check for blockages.

    Re: ewn14780w interlock

    If you look at a new interlock, when an interlock locks with power aplied to it, a thermo actuator heats up & pushes a little pin, usually a square button is pushed out which keeps door locked so it can’t be mechanically opened while machine is on & for a few minutes after cycle finishes, the thermo actuator should cool down & release.
    If theres a fault sometimes the pin/button sticks & does’nt release. If you look at a new interlock, locate where this is you can get a machine released by pushing it in with a small screwdriver.
    If its handle broken, you should still be able to push latch pin, with top off reach down to interlock you can see metal latch coming through interlock, it should move with a screwdriver to side, then pull door & it should open.

    Re: Leisure RCM10CRS

    Theres a thermal fuse in series with the feed cable from terminal block at rear to clock & oven controls. Its located at the back oven of the oven. Not terminal & hopefully not too expensive, power off before removing any covers or doing work to it.
    You need to test that the oven thermostat is cutting out as if it was’nt this thermal cut-out switch should go out on over temperature.

    Re: Beko DRCS68W

    Felt on its own (sewed type) 2964220200
    It is recommended to fit the front bearing assy’ 2966000300 s’num’ up to 10…09, 2966001100 from s’num’ 10…10 to cure the problem of belt breakages, the bearing assembly includes the felt.
    Front of drum needs to be cleaned of stickiness from felt failure.

    Re: Miele G643 dishwasher Intake/pump light flashing

    Problems something arising with Miele d’washers are water in base activating float, flow meter sticking, circulation pump not getting full pressure because of blockage in impellors. The best thing for you to do is time the second fill, if it takes more than 4 mins to get the required amount of pulses from the flowmeter it will throw upinlet/drain fault.
    This could just be a seating problem of the reed switch p.c.b not being able to pick up the impulses from magnet flow or as simple as a bad connection.
